The community health nurse provides care for a diverse group of clients, several of whom have acne vulgaris. For which client would the use of isotretinoin be most appropriate?
a) An adult client whose cystic acne has not responded to conservative treatment
b) Isotretinoin is reserved for moderate to severe cases of acne due to the significant risks of adverse effects. It is absolutely contraindicated during pregnancy due to
the risk of birth defects. It would not be used with clients who have just begun to experience acne or who experience occasional breakouts
